Returning Customer ?
Don't have an account ?
No products in the cart.
Showing 21061–21075 of 24818 results
pr-4573102640611-AUG-2023
till qty are full/ Estimated Arrival Dec. 2023
pr-4573102666123
till qty are full/Arrival Est. Oct. 2024
pr-4573102657718-MARCH-2024
pr2022-0191
Deadline May 4, 2022 / Estimated Arrival Aug 2022
pr-4573102657732-MARCH-2024
pr-4573102640529R-jun-2024
Deadline jun-21-2024/Arrival Est. Dec. 2024
pr-4573102640529
Deadline till qty are full/ Estimated Arrival June 2023
pr-4573102657787R-jun-2024
pr-4573102657725-MARCH-2024
pr-4573102656797-APR-2024
Deadline Jun-10-2024/Arrival Est. Dec. 2024
pr-4573102666116
pr2021-0803
Deadline Oct. 18, 2021 / Estimated Arrival April 2022
pr-4573102666130
pr-4573102657756-MARCH-2024
pr-4573102657756
till qty are full/ Estimated Arrival Jan. 2024